Great news for the Cincinnati area! Our request for a $1.6 billion DOT grant for the Brent Spence Bridge has been approved. Looking forward to the successful completion of this critical project.

Had a great meeting with Warren County Engineer Neil Tunison to discuss the widening of State Rt. 63 and the King Ave. project. Fortunately, the Rt. 63 project received funding from Congress last year, and King Ave. funding has been approved by the House this year.
